AI Automation Engineer

Exer Medical CorporationEl Segundo, CA
$100,000 - $120,000Onsite

About The Position

Exer Urgent Care is running an AI and automation transformation program across finance, operations, and clinical-support functions, led by the Chief AI Officer. We're looking for an early-career engineer to join as a hands-on builder, someone who can take a spec, a rough sketch, or a "here's the problem" conversation and turn it into a working automation quickly. This isn't a maintenance role on an established team. You'll work directly with the CAIO, picking up real build projects already in flight and helping stand up new ones, with real autonomy and a short distance between idea and shipped tool.

Requirements

  • 1 to 3 years of professional software engineering experience (a new grad with strong internships is also a great fit).
  • Solid TypeScript/JavaScript, comfortable working in React and Next.js.
  • Working knowledge of relational databases (Postgres or similar).
  • Genuine curiosity about applied AI: prompt engineering, LLM APIs, or agent frameworks, even if that experience comes from personal projects rather than a job.
  • Comfortable with ambiguity. Specs here often start as a planning doc or a conversation, not a fully scoped ticket.
  • Able to work independently once pointed at a problem, and to flag blockers early rather than sit on them.
  • Based in or willing to work from the Los Angeles area out of Exer's corporate office.

Nice To Haves

  • Supabase experience.
  • Exposure to browser-automation or RPA-style tooling.
  • Experience with background job or workflow-orchestration systems.
  • Familiarity with deploying on Vercel or similar platforms.
  • Any experience handling sensitive or regulated data carefully, healthcare or finance, even from coursework or an internship.

Responsibilities

  • Extend vendor coverage on an existing browser-automation pipeline that logs into vendor portals, pulls invoices, and feeds them into finance systems.
  • Pull structured data out of lease documents and reconcile it against landlord statements.
  • Build structured intake tools, AI-assisted workflows, and small internal apps that give non-technical staff a simple front end to something AI-powered underneath.
  • Manage databases, spreadsheet and workspace-tool integrations, business-intelligence connections, and wiring up systems that hold data.
  • Develop fast, scrappy proofs of concept that test whether an automation idea holds up before committing real build time.
